I am Myeonghyeon Kim, a master's student at KAIST working on autonomous mobile robot navigation in urban intersection environments. My research focuses on SPaT/R2X-assisted crosswalk navigation, ROS 2-based robotic systems, LiDAR-based navigation, and infrastructure-aware intersection intelligence.

Current Work

Recent Research Progress

Recent work centers on turning crosswalk navigation into a deployable robotic system: from real-world R2X/SPaT experiments to simulation-based validation and LiDAR-driven autonomous navigation.

ITSC 2026

SPaT/R2X AMR Crosswalk Navigation

Developed a time-aware AMR crossing framework using SPaT remaining-time information and a Time-to-Cross decision rule.

Robotics System

Delivery Robot ROS 2 Integration

Built a Delivery Robot simulation and integration pipeline with LiDAR, IMU, camera, odometry, joint states, and ROS 2 topics.

SLAM / Navigation

Fast-LIO2 and Nav2 Pipeline

Configured LiDAR-based SLAM and navigation components to support map generation, localization, and autonomous driving tests.
